日韩欧美视频第二区,秋霞成人午夜鲁丝一区二区三区,美女日批视频在线观看,av在线不卡免费

電子開(kāi)發(fā)網(wǎng)

電子開(kāi)發(fā)網(wǎng)電子設(shè)計(jì) | 電子開(kāi)發(fā)網(wǎng)Rss 2.0 會(huì)員中心 會(huì)員注冊(cè)
搜索: 您現(xiàn)在的位置: 電子開(kāi)發(fā)網(wǎng) >> 電子開(kāi)發(fā) >> 單片機(jī)實(shí)例 >> 正文

AVR定時(shí)器1的CTC模式設(shè)置

作者:佚名    文章來(lái)源:本站原創(chuàng)    點(diǎn)擊數(shù):    更新時(shí)間:2018-12-19

avr單片機(jī)在CTC模式編程的時(shí)候,要執(zhí)行的步驟如下:

1. 將PD4~PD5 設(shè)置為輸出(默認(rèn)為低電平)。DDRD|=BIT(4)|BIT(5);
2. 決定比較輸出模式,試驗(yàn)中為模式電平取反。TCCR1A=0x50;
3. 決定方波產(chǎn)生模式位,試驗(yàn)中是模式4, 亦即WGM12=1。TCCR1B|=BIT(3);
4. 決定分頻N,這里就假設(shè)去1 吧,無(wú)預(yù)分頻。TCCR1B|=BIT(0);
5. 在步驟3 中,方波產(chǎn)生模式位為4,換句話(huà)說(shuō)就是OCR1A 決定匹配的最大值。
CTC模式實(shí)際上就是比較輸出模式,輸出占空比相同的脈沖    頻率=時(shí)鐘晶振/2N(1+OCRnA)
如:四個(gè)指令就可以配置好CTC模式(8M,輸出2KHz):
   DDRD|=0X30;
   TCCR1A=0X50;
   TCCR1B=0X09;  
   OCR1A=1999;
 
#include <iom16v.h>
#include <macros.h>
void main()
{
   DDRD|=0X30; //set PD4 and PD5 iS out
   TCCR1A=0X50; //開(kāi)啟OC1A OC1B
   TCCR1B=0X09; //配合TCCR1A,設(shè)置OC1A和OC1B為CTC模式,CTC時(shí)鐘源選擇系統(tǒng)8M時(shí)鐘
   OCR1A=999; //設(shè)置OC1A的輸出頻率為4KHZ
   OCR1B=59999; //設(shè)置OC1B的輸出頻率為200/3Hz
}
Tags:單片機(jī),AVR,定時(shí)器  
責(zé)任編輯:admin
  • 上一篇文章:
  • 下一篇文章: 沒(méi)有了
  • 相關(guān)文章列表
    PLC定時(shí)器和計(jì)數(shù)器的應(yīng)用程序,定時(shí)器梯形圖
    單片機(jī)超聲波視覺(jué)識(shí)別系統(tǒng)的測(cè)量軟件開(kāi)發(fā),超聲波測(cè)距
    LCD1602的單片機(jī)驅(qū)動(dòng)詳解
    西門(mén)子PLC的定時(shí)器指令系統(tǒng)
    西門(mén)子PLC定時(shí)器指令
    三菱PLC定時(shí)器擴(kuò)展方法梯形圖
    西門(mén)子PLC定時(shí)器定時(shí)時(shí)間太短?巧用計(jì)數(shù)器延長(zhǎng)計(jì)時(shí)時(shí)間
    單片機(jī)時(shí)鐘電路原理
    S7-200如何實(shí)現(xiàn)多個(gè)寄存器的累加,mov指令
    西門(mén)子s7-200和s7-300定時(shí)器使用區(qū)別,TON指令
    基于stc89c52的4*4矩陣鍵盤(pán)輸入數(shù)碼管,一個(gè)小計(jì)算器
    單片機(jī)紅外遙控器設(shè)計(jì)
    單片機(jī) 鍵盤(pán)檢測(cè)與應(yīng)用
    如何給單片機(jī)系統(tǒng)提供可靠的電磁兼容設(shè)計(jì),pcb設(shè)計(jì)
    小白必看:?jiǎn)纹瑱C(jī)系統(tǒng)電路經(jīng)典設(shè)計(jì)教學(xué)
    兩款分立元件定時(shí)器制作
    單穩(wěn)態(tài)觸發(fā)式定時(shí)電路,NE555 Uni-stable state circuit
    西門(mén)子PLC定時(shí)器ton與tonr的區(qū)別
    定時(shí)器使用之西門(mén)子plc彩燈循環(huán)控制編程設(shè)計(jì)
    利用定時(shí)器與計(jì)數(shù)器設(shè)計(jì)一PLC控制的長(zhǎng)延時(shí)電路
    閃爍電路PLC梯形圖
    CD4060 魚(yú)缸間歇充氧定時(shí)器電路,間歇啟動(dòng)電路
    多定時(shí)器組合控制的PLC線(xiàn)路與梯形圖
    梯形圖實(shí)例PLC定時(shí)器應(yīng)用程序編程實(shí)例
    定時(shí)器與計(jì)數(shù)器組合的延時(shí)PLC程序梯形圖
    簡(jiǎn)易定時(shí)器電路圖,Simple Timer
    單片機(jī)上拉電阻和下拉電阻的用處和區(qū)別
    單片機(jī)數(shù)碼管顯示原理
    51單片機(jī)--矩陣鍵盤(pán)
    詳解:上拉電阻的作用【圖文】
    請(qǐng)文明參與討論,禁止漫罵攻擊,不要惡意評(píng)論、違禁詞語(yǔ)。 昵稱(chēng):
    1分 2分 3分 4分 5分

    還可以輸入 200 個(gè)字
    [ 查看全部 ] 網(wǎng)友評(píng)論
    最新推薦
    熱門(mén)文章
    • 此欄目下沒(méi)有熱點(diǎn)文章
    關(guān)于我們 - 聯(lián)系我們 - 廣告服務(wù) - 友情鏈接 - 網(wǎng)站地圖 - 版權(quán)聲明 - 在線(xiàn)幫助 - 文章列表
    返回頂部
    刷新頁(yè)面
    下到頁(yè)底
    晶體管查詢(xún)
    主站蜘蛛池模板: 雷波县| 揭西县| 鱼台县| 舒城县| 通山县| 仁寿县| 济南市| 柏乡县| 离岛区| 滨州市| 普兰店市| 皋兰县| 平湖市| 城固县| 乌拉特中旗| 霍邱县| 丽江市| 金秀| 绥棱县| 宜城市| 汶川县| 维西| 肥乡县| 东丰县| 积石山| 漾濞| 麟游县| 红原县| 稻城县| 广东省| 鄱阳县| 沽源县| 连南| 青神县| 彰武县| 建水县| 南城县| 灵寿县| 商水县| 河东区| 滕州市|